Fascial Release Therapy
Fascial Release Therapy (Myofascial Release) is a gentle, hands-on treatment that targets the fascia—the thin, web-like connective tissue that surrounds and supports muscles, joints, and organs. Due to injury, poor posture, stress, or repetitive strain, this fascia can become tight or restricted, leading to pain, stiffness, and reduced mobility. Using slow, sustained pressure and stretching techniques, fascial release helps restore the elasticity and glide of this tissue, allowing the body to move more freely and comfortably.

This therapy is especially effective for conditions like back and neck pain, sports injuries, postural imbalances, and long-standing stiffness. It may involve direct contact with the skin over specific areas, so appropriate exposure of the treatment region is sometimes required for optimal results.
